The Complete Experience: What You Can Expect

Starting Point and Arrival

Your journey begins at Finca Treurer, situated at Ctra. Llucmajor, Km. 5.7, just a short drive from Palma. The meet-up is straightforward, and with a mobile ticket, you can keep things simple. Tours start promptly at 11:00 am, allowing you to enjoy Mallorca’s midday sunshine as you step into a genuine Majorcan setting.

Walking Through the Olive Grove

Once assembled, the owner—often Miguel, as reviews suggest—takes you on a walk through the finca and the olive grove. You’ll see various olive trees, some possibly centuries old, and learn about the different types of olives and their significance in Majorcan culture. As one reviewer mentioned, “the views are so serene,” a sentiment many share about the tranquil landscape. The experience isn’t rushed; the owner’s storytelling makes the walk both educational and relaxed.

Learning About Olive Oil Production

This is the heart of the experience. You’ll learn how olives are harvested, the importance of quality standards for EVOO, and the steps involved in processing. Reviewers highlight the knowledgeable guides—with one saying, “Miguel was great, personable, fun, and passionate”—which makes the technical parts accessible and engaging. You’ll see the new production facilities and get a sense of how small-scale craftsmanship results in high-quality oil.

Frequently Asked Questions

Visit the Finca and olive grove, extra virgin olive oil tasting and snack - Frequently Asked Questions

How long does the tour last?
The tour lasts approximately 1 hour 45 minutes, giving you plenty of time to enjoy the walk, learn about olive oil production, and taste the products.

Where does the tour start?
It begins at Finca Treurer on Ctra. Llucmajor, Km. 5.7, easily accessible from Palma. The meeting point is straightforward, and the experience is confirmed with a mobile ticket.

Is the tour suitable for children or those with mobility issues?
Since the tour involves walking through the olive grove and outdoor areas, it’s best suited for those comfortable with mild outdoor activity. Most travelers can participate, and service animals are allowed.

What’s included in the experience?
You’ll receive a guided walk through the finca and olive grove, an olive oil tasting, and a snack featuring local Majorcan products. Beverages such as wine may also be served.

Can dietary restrictions be accommodated?
Yes, reviewers mention that the hosts are good at catering to specific dietary needs, including gluten-free or dairy-free options.

What about group size?
The maximum group size is 20 travelers, which helps ensure a relaxed, engaging experience where questions and personal interaction are encouraged.

When should I book?
It’s recommended to book in advance, especially since there are 5+ bookings last month and high reviews. Tours start at 11:00 am and are popular among visitors seeking an authentic experience.

What if the weather is bad?
The tour requires good weather. If canceled due to poor conditions, you’ll be offered an alternative date or a full refund, making it a low-risk choice.
